I also have been looking at DD's cousin the Audioque, Sound Splinter, TC 1000, Elemental Designs 9Kv.2, JL Audio 8W7, or the Kicker 8L7. The only question mainly between the Sound Splinter, and the DD1508 is there is a 5 pound difference in weight, and I don't know if that means that the motor assembly is stronger in the Sound Splinter, or if it is just extra weight. DD and Audioque both have an advantage over any other subwoofer. Solid copper speaker terminals straight from the voice coil, is a better connection than a binding post. There is less resistance between having a soldered connection and a solid copper to copper connection. It does make sense. So if they have overbuilt that part of the Sub, then the other parts of the sub must be top notch also.
